Can Casper on the Ledger prevent double-spending attacks in the cryptocurrency ecosystem?

- Boisen KehoeApr 06, 2025 · a year agoCasper on the Ledger is a consensus algorithm designed to prevent double-spending attacks in the cryptocurrency ecosystem. It works by introducing a proof-of-stake mechanism, where validators are required to lock up a certain amount of cryptocurrency as collateral. This incentivizes them to validate transactions honestly, as they risk losing their collateral if they attempt to double-spend. Additionally, Casper on the Ledger uses a finality mechanism to confirm the validity of transactions, further reducing the risk of double-spending attacks. Overall, Casper on the Ledger provides a secure and efficient solution to prevent double-spending attacks in the cryptocurrency ecosystem.
